The Himalaya are approaching a tipping point ​as glaciers melt faster than a decade ago, threatening ‌water security as the region approaches “peak water“ ​by mid-century, according to a study ⁠released this month.

The findings come after the collapse of a Himalayan glacier in late August along the Nepal-Tibet border, ‌which caused cascading landslides and flash floods in the valleys below. At least 1,300 people ‌have been confirmed dead and more ‌than ⁠5,300 are missing across Nepal and China’s Tibet ⁠region.

As glaciers retreat, they are leaving behind unstable glacial lakes held back by little more than loose rock and ice, above ​valleys where millions ‌of people live, the study found.

Peak water is the point in time when river flows stop rising and ​start declining. It is expected to have profound implications for water security. As the Himalaya underpin more ⁠than 20% of India’s GDP, the region makes up ⁠a key piece of the country’s national economic infrastructure, upon which hundreds of millions of ‌people depend.

The study was produced by Systemiq, a sustainability advisory firm, together with the Integrated Mountain Initiative, the International Centre ‌for Integrated Mountain Development, and India’s G.B. Pant ​National Institute of Himalayan Environment.

Himalayan glacier mass loss had accelerated in recent decades, while ⁠only 21 glaciers were currently monitored on the ground out of an estimated 40,000 glaciers across the ‌Hindu Kush-Himalaya region, a vast mountain system spanning eight countries from Afghanistan to Myanmar, the study found.

Though making up around 18% of India’s land, the Himalayan region accounted for roughly ​35% of the country’s natural disasters.
